Auf einen Blick
- Aufgaben: Optimiere unser Logistiksystem und integriere KI-Technologien für effiziente Abläufe.
- Arbeitgeber: Innovatives Unternehmen mit einem offenen und kreativen Arbeitsumfeld.
- Mitarbeitervorteile: Flexible Arbeitszeiten, ergonomische Arbeitsplätze und zahlreiche Unternehmensrabatte.
- Warum dieser Job: Gestalte die Zukunft der Logistik mit modernster Technologie und einem tollen Team.
- GewĂĽnschte Qualifikationen: Erfahrung in Python, Django oder FastAPI sowie Frontend-Entwicklung mit React.
- Andere Informationen: Feiere deinen Geburtstag mit einem halben Tag frei und genieße Bürohunde für eine entspannte Atmosphäre.
Das voraussichtliche Gehalt liegt zwischen 43200 - 72000 € pro Jahr.
Your mission
- Build and optimize the logistics and warehouse management system to support business growth.
- Apply AI technologies and internal models to automate and improve operational processes.
- Integrate robotics and modern tools into warehouse workflows.
- Design, develop, and deploy scalable backend services using Python, Django, and FastAPI.
- Contribute to software architecture discussions and decisions, ensuring long-term scalability.
- Analyze and translate complex business requirements into efficient technical solutions.
- Participate in agile ceremonies and take ownership of delivering high-quality results.
- Write and maintain technical documentation, including RFCs, HLDs, and LLDs.
- Share knowledge, support teammates through pair programming, and contribute to a strong engineering culture.
Our Tech Stack
- Python, Flask, FastAPI, Django
- Google Cloud, PubSub, GKE, Compute Engine, Cloud Functions
- MongoDB, MySQL, PostgreSQL
- GitLab, CI/CD
- Docker, Kubernetes
- React, TypeScript
- TDD, DDD
Your profile
- Several years of professional experience with Python and FastAPI or Django.
- Proven hands‑on experience in frontend development using React.
- Strong knowledge of MongoDB and familiar with MySQL.
- Familiarity with cloud technologies, ideally Google Cloud Platform (GCP), and solid experience with distributed systems.
- A true team player with strong communication skills and a collaborative mindset.
- Comfortable working in Linux/Unix environments.
- Passionate about testing, clean architecture, and writing high-quality code.
- Understanding of Domain Driven Design and hexagonal architecture is a plus.
- We can only accept applications with a valid work permit.
You can look forward to
- Flexible working hours: We work according to a hybrid model that offers you maximum flexibility while also fostering important personal connections. Whether in our centrally located office or working remotely – you and your team decide together where and when you want to work. You can arrange your working hours flexibly. For personal interaction, your team meets at least 20 days per quarter in the office, as our team days are held in person.
- Individual work environment: Design your ergonomic workspace just the way you like it – with height-adjustable desks and the laptop of your choice (MacBook or ThinkPad). If things get a bit noisy in the office, your Bose noise‑cancelling headphones ensure uninterrupted focus. If needed, we can also provide you with an ergonomic chair or additional monitors for your home office.
- 1/2 day off on your birthday: Celebrate your birthday with half a day of vacation! Come in later, leave earlier, or simply take an additional half day off to have your entire birthday free – provided your birthday falls on a regular working day. Additionally, you get half a day off on December 24th and 31st.
- Office dogs: Our office dogs contribute to a relaxed work atmosphere and are always happy to receive some extra cuddles.
- Reduced ticket for the public transport: Save real money with the Germany or Job Ticket for the Berlin S-Bahn.
- Company discounts: As a momoxian, you can look forward to a monthly voucher for our momox Fashion online shop, as well as medimops. Additionally, you benefit from numerous company discounts from our partners.
- Sport and fitness offers: During the week, you have the opportunity to take part in various sports activities. Whether it\’s online training, massages, or stretching at your desk – there\’s something for everyone. You can also get a discounted membership for Urban Sports Club or Wellhub.
- Training: momox is only as good as you. That\’s why you will find room and budget for your individual professional development with language classes, internal training, conferences, (online) courses and more.
- Open work environment: We work together in a bright, open‑plan office where even the few existing doors are always open. Our teams are motivated and open to new ideas. Bring your creativity to the table and make things happen! If you need a moment of peace, you can retreat to a cozy corner of the medimops library in the break room, or recharge with a game of foosball, table tennis, or PlayStation.
- Sustainability: We love second‑hand and incorporate our sustainable business idea into the office routine with simple methods like using eco‑friendly supplies, double‑sided printing, energy‑saving modes on devices, waste separation, etc. In doing so, we take responsibility and integrate sustainability into all our activities.
#J-18808-Ljbffr
Full Stack Engineer - Python (m/f/d) Arbeitgeber: momox
Kontaktperson:
momox HR Team
StudySmarter Bewerbungstipps 🤫
So bekommst du den Job: Full Stack Engineer - Python (m/f/d)
✨Tipp Nummer 1
Netzwerken ist der SchlĂĽssel! Nutze Plattformen wie LinkedIn, um mit anderen Fachleuten in Kontakt zu treten. Teile deine Projekte und Erfahrungen, um sichtbar zu werden und vielleicht sogar Empfehlungen zu erhalten.
✨Tipp Nummer 2
Bereite dich auf technische Interviews vor! Übe Coding-Challenges und sei bereit, deine Lösungen zu erklären. Wir empfehlen dir, an Mock-Interviews teilzunehmen, um dein Selbstvertrauen zu stärken.
✨Tipp Nummer 3
Zeige deine Leidenschaft für Technologie! Sprich über deine Lieblingsprojekte und wie du innovative Lösungen entwickelt hast. Das zeigt, dass du nicht nur die Anforderungen erfüllst, sondern auch einen echten Beitrag leisten möchtest.
✨Tipp Nummer 4
Bewirb dich direkt über unsere Website! So kannst du sicherstellen, dass deine Bewerbung schnell und effizient bearbeitet wird. Und vergiss nicht, deine Fragen zur Unternehmenskultur oder den Projekten zu stellen – das zeigt dein Interesse!
Diese Fähigkeiten machen dich zur top Bewerber*in für die Stelle: Full Stack Engineer - Python (m/f/d)
Tipps für deine Bewerbung 🫡
Sei du selbst!: Wir wollen dich kennenlernen, also zeig uns, wer du wirklich bist! Lass deine Persönlichkeit in deinem Anschreiben durchscheinen und erzähl uns, warum du für die Rolle als Full Stack Engineer bei uns brennst.
Technische Fähigkeiten hervorheben: Stell sicher, dass du deine Erfahrungen mit Python, Django und FastAPI klar darstellst. Zeig uns, wie du diese Technologien in der Vergangenheit eingesetzt hast, um Probleme zu lösen oder Projekte voranzutreiben.
Beziehe dich auf unsere Tech-Stack: Mach dir die Mühe, unseren Tech-Stack zu verstehen und erwähne spezifische Tools oder Technologien, mit denen du gearbeitet hast. Das zeigt uns, dass du dich mit unserer Arbeitsweise identifizieren kannst und bereit bist, dich schnell einzuarbeiten.
Bewirb dich über unsere Website: Der einfachste Weg, um Teil unseres Teams zu werden, ist, dich direkt über unsere Website zu bewerben. So stellst du sicher, dass deine Bewerbung an die richtige Stelle gelangt und wir sie schnellstmöglich bearbeiten können!
Wie du dich auf ein Vorstellungsgespräch bei momox vorbereitest
✨Verstehe die Technologien
Mach dich mit den Technologien vertraut, die in der Stellenbeschreibung erwähnt werden, insbesondere Python, Django und FastAPI. Zeige im Interview, dass du nicht nur die Grundlagen kennst, sondern auch, wie du diese Technologien in realen Projekten angewendet hast.
✨Bereite Beispiele vor
Denke an konkrete Projekte oder Herausforderungen, die du in der Vergangenheit gemeistert hast. Sei bereit, diese zu erläutern und zu zeigen, wie du komplexe Anforderungen in technische Lösungen übersetzt hast. Das zeigt deine praktische Erfahrung und Problemlösungsfähigkeiten.
✨Teamarbeit betonen
Da Teamarbeit und Kommunikation wichtig sind, solltest du Beispiele für erfolgreiche Zusammenarbeit in agilen Teams parat haben. Erkläre, wie du Wissen geteilt hast und wie Pair Programming dir geholfen hat, bessere Ergebnisse zu erzielen.
✨Fragen stellen
Bereite einige Fragen vor, die du dem Interviewer stellen kannst. Das zeigt dein Interesse an der Position und dem Unternehmen. Frage nach der Unternehmenskultur, den aktuellen Projekten oder wie das Team zusammenarbeitet, um innovative Lösungen zu entwickeln.